As nouns, mignonette is a hyponym of reseda; that is, mignonette is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than reseda:
  • reseda: any plant of the genus Reseda
  • mignonette: Mediterranean woody annual widely cultivated for its dense terminal spikelike clusters greenish or yellowish white flowers having an intense spicy fragrance
